Abstract
The utility model discloses multi-directional automatic switching equipment for finished materials of sludge blending combustion and mixing equipment. The automatic switching equipment comprises a rotary distributor positioned below a discharge port of a mixing cylinder; a hopper is arranged at the upper end of the rotary distributor; the rotary distributor is driven by an air cylinder and can allow a discharge port of the hopper to be selectively positioned in two different stations under the control of a controller; the two stations are over against a feed end of a discharge conveyor and a feed end of a storage yard conveyor respectively; a discharge end of the discharge conveyor is connected into a storage hopper; a two-way conveyor is arranged below a discharge port of the storage hopper; two discharge ends of the two-way conveyor are connected with two coal conveying flow lines used for thermal power fuel conveying respectively; and the materials can be distributed to the two coal conveying flow lines by changing a conveying direction of the two-way conveyor. With the adoption of the structure, the automatic switching equipment is simple in structure, low in manufacturing cost, and simple and convenient in treatment process, improves the production efficiency, and lowers the treatment cost.

Principle of work of the present utility model is as follows:
As shown in the figure, during work, coal and mud are in 1 li stirring of a mixing bowl, and the finished product material that stirs is by the discharging opening output of a mixing bowl 1; Rotary tripper 2 is positioned at the below of a mixing bowl 1 discharging opening, rotary tripper 2 is by cylinder 3 controls, can automatically switch to production model and stockyard pattern as required, the finished product material that a mixing bowl 1 can be stirred through rotary tripper 2 is transported to discharge conveyor 5 or stockyard conveyer 6 respectively thus, the material that discharge conveyor 5 is carried is introduced into storage bin hopper 7, entering bidirectional conveyor 8 by storage bin hopper 7, bidirectional conveyor 8 can positive and negatively be rotated, and can as required the finished product material be transported to wherein one the tunnel to fail on the coal conveyor line 9.
